Fire engulfs 2 townhomes in Fairfax County

FAIRFAX COUNTY, Va. (DC News Now) — Large flames and thick black smoke could be seen coming from the Franconia area after two homes caught fire Sunday night.

Minutes after 9 p.m. on Feb. 1, the Fairfax County Fire and Rescue Department responded to multiple calls for a fire quickly spreading in the 6500 block of Gladys May Lane. There, crews found heavy flames spewing from two townhomes.

As a result, firefighters sounded a second alarm.

As of Sunday night, the fire department noted that the bulk of the fire was in the basement, where a “gas-fed” fire continued to spread. Washington Gas was called to the scene.

A video posted on social media showed the homes consumed in heavy orange flames. The fire could also be seen pouring from the windows and the roof…
